But if remove id("io.spring.dependency-management") version "1.0.7.RELEASE" from my build config and will use version of spring boot like this compile("org.springframework.boot:spring-boot-starter-web:2.1.5.RELEASE") test runs correctly.
Spring dependency management brokes my junit5 tests. Please can anyone explain why this is happening and how to solve the problem? Thanks!

It would appear that adding Spring Dependency Management changes some of the transitive dependencies for your junit-jupiter dependencies.
Your declared junit version (5.4.2) depends on junit-platform-commons 1.4.2, but when you add Spring Dependency Management it is changing the commons version from 1.4.2 to 1.3.2. This is why you are receiving the NoSuchMethodError since that method was added in version four!
Here's two solutions I can think of:
1) (I recommend this) Drop your declared junit version and let Spring Dependency Management handle everything for junit:
testImplementation("org.junit.jupiter:junit-jupiter-api")
testRuntime("org.junit.jupiter:junit-jupiter-engine")
2) Declare the transitive dependency versions for junit (this would allow you to carry on using version 5.4.2 if this is a must-have)
testImplementation("org.junit.jupiter:junit-jupiter-api:5.4.2")
testImplementation("org.junit.platform:junit-platform-commons:1.4.2")
testRuntime("org.junit.jupiter:junit-jupiter-engine:5.4.2")
testRuntime("org.junit.platform:junit-platform-engine:1.4.2")

I suspect your problem is because of known classloader issues with plugins exercised with Gradle's TestKit.
I will paraphrase what that link says: Your plugin and its runtime classpath are loaded with one classloader. The functional test and its classpath are loaded in yet a second different classloader. Such a situation is the classic recipe for NoClassDefFoundErrors. Therefore, when using TestKit with a custom plugin, the plugin's runtime classpath must be explicitly injected into the runtime classpath of the functional test that is exercising the plugin.
The way your project is organized — with the functional test as a subproject — is likely to compound those known classloader issues. It certainly makes things more complicated than they need to be.
The answer to your question, therefore, is: Reorganize your project.

Ignoring module-info.class at test-runtime is "Resort to the class-path": https://sormuras.github.io/blog/2018-09-11-testing-in-the-modular-world#resort-to-the-classpath -- your tests may access internal classes as before. All modular boundaries are discarded.
If you want stay in the modular world when doing white box tests, you need to patch your main and test modules into a single one. Either at test compile or test runtime. More information about that test modes can also be found in the blog linked above.
For a Gradle setup you may either use the JUnit ConsoleLauncher manually or re-configure the Gradle runtime paths like described here https://guides.gradle.org/building-java-9-modules/ and/or use https://github.com/zyxist/chainsaw
Works if I add a filter in build.gradle:
test {
useJUnitPlatform()
filter {
exclude '**/module-info.class'
}
}

I assume you are using Maven/Gradle, any build tool.
I was working on a spring MVC project and added LDAP functionality, however I added the LDAP jar dependency on the top of the dependency list in pom.xml and the jar version I used, utilized a lower version of spring core which did not have the ConversionService class. I identified this by back tracking to what was the most recent change to the Spring jar versions I made(i.e. added ldap libs) and using the Maven - Dependency hierarchy tab to identify what had changed. Once I removed the new dependency. did a clean, install, add the dependencies to the bottom of the list. The issue was fixed.
Your resolved dependencies should have the highest spring core version referenced on the column on the left. Any lower version should be omitted. In the screenshot, notice that spring core 4.3.9 is omitted for 4.3.4. Avoid this by adding the dependencies that use lower spring core versions below those which use higher versions.
